Abstract :
In the work the method of designing of two-contours tuned quasipolynomial bandstop filters (QBSFs) on lumped elements with a parallel resonance is offered, besides their electric characteristics within the range of frequencies and the range of tuning are considered. The feasibility of construction of two-contours tuned bandstop filters (BSFs) on lumped elements with a parallel resonance is shown and the results of computing and natural experiments are submitted.
